CDDA paranoia
Cd/Dvd Tools
CDDA paranoia is an open source command line utility for Linux that allows advanced analysis and data extraction from CD/DVD/Blu-ray discs. It can be used to verify data integrity and ensure maximum read accuracy.

FILExt
Office & Productivity
FILExt is a free online database of file extensions and associated programs. It allows users to easily identify unknown file types by file extension and provides information on thousands of file formats.
